Sandboarding at the Sand Dunes

Sandboarding at the Sand Dunes

Paoay, Ilocos Norte, Philippines

The sand dunes of La Paz and Paoay, the natural coastal desert shaped by sea and wind, are located along the coast near Laoag City. Its rolling and sometimes steep slopes make it a perfect place for a heart-pumping 4x4 ride and sandboarding.

San Agustin Church of Paoay

San Agustin Church of Paoay

Paoay, Ilocos Region, Philippines

The San Agustin Church, otherwise known as the Paoay Church, is famous for its distinct architecture highlighted by the enormous buttresses on the sides and back of the building. Dating its construction as early as 1593 and completed by 1710, the church has already witnessed and survived a lot of calamities owing to its preventive Baroque-influenced structure.

Malacañang of the North

Malacañang of the North

Paoay, Ilocos Region, Philippines

The residence was built by the Philippine Tourism Authority in 1977 for Marcos's 60th birthday, and served as an official residence for the president's family when they were staying in Ilocos Norte. With its sprawling expanse, this imposing mansion is intricately designed and has a mix of Spanish and Ilocano architecture. The result is quite majestic, and one of its finest features is the magnificent view, with the house looking out over well tended gardens and the beautiful Paoay Lake.

Cape Bojeador Lighthouse

Cape Bojeador Lighthouse

Burgos, Ilocos Region, Philippines

The lighthouse of Cape Bojeador, located in Burgos, Ilocos Norte, is the Philippines’ highest elevated lighthouse that is still active and kept in the original structure dating back to the Spanish-Colonial period. It is one of the most visited attractions in the area.
